Biography

Glaucio Paulino is the Margareta Engman Augustine Professor in the Department of Civil and Environmental Engineering and the Princeton Materials Institute at Princeton University. His research primarily focuses on advanced computational methods for material design, particularly in the areas of mechanics of materials, optimization, and applied mathematics. He has made significant contributions to the understanding of how materials respond under various conditions, which has implications across engineering disciplines including civil, mechanical, and aerospace engineering. In addition to his teaching and research responsibilities, Paulino is actively involved in mentoring students and collaborating on interdisciplinary projects that bridge the gap between theoretical research and real-world applications. His work encompasses both fundamental studies and practical implementations, addressing critical challenges in material science and engineering.
